It seems the first command not replied properly is the above CPMS setting, which is the SMS-storage related configuration, IIRC. I would try the above command on its own (AT+CPMS="ME","ME","ME") passed to the modem through a direct minicom connection without modem-manager in place, and see if the modem chokes on it or what. If it does, the output of "AT+CPMS?" and "AT+CPMS=?" will also be useful. If any special CPMS configuration is needed, I recently sent to the ML a new plugin for review which also needed special CPMS commands, so the fix to enable plugins use their own CPMS should be there.
